Define a relation M on N by (x, y) epsilon M if one only if x Greaterthanorequalto 2y is M reflexive, Anti-reflexive, or neither? Is m symmetric, Anti-symmetric, or neither? Is m transitive? Dose M define an equivalence relation on N?

Solution

a.

For no natural number ,x do we have

x>=2x

Hence, M is anti reflexive

b.

Let, xMy

Hence, x>=2y

Let, yMx

y>=2x>=4y

So,

y>=4y

which is not possible for any natural number y

Hence M is anti symmetric

c)

Let, xMy and yMz

x>=2y,y>=2z

x>=2y>=4z

x>=4z hence, x>=2z

Hence, M is transitive

d.

M is not equivalence since it is not symmetric or reflexive.
